How Our Team Performs Crawl Space Water Extraction

Our team follows a rigorous process to ensure your crawl space is dry and safe. We start by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the water. From there, we’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the area completely. This process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ll inspect your crawl space to find out the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home to its original condition. Our team will identify any structural issues or potential health hazards and address them quickly.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using powerful pumps and wet vacuums, our team will extract the water from your crawl space, removing any standing water and moisture.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and health risks.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your crawl space completely, including dehumidifiers and fans.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ring your home is safe to occupy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your crawl space, removing any dirt, debris, or bacteria that may have accumulated during the water damage. This step is crucial in preventing health risks and ensuring your home is safe for your family.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Finally, our team will restore your crawl space to its original condition, repairing any structural damage and replacing any damaged materials.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report outlining the work we’ve done and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ction

Ignoring the signs can lead to costly damage and health risks. Here are some common warning signs you need crawl space water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your crawl space can be a sign of mo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ore these odors, as they can spread to other areas of your home and cause health problems.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Water stains on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age in your crawl space. If left unchecked, these stains can lead to costly repairs and health risks.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age in your crawl space.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th in your crawl space can be a sign of moisture and health risks.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can spread to other areas of your home and cause serious health problems.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your crawl space can be a sign of mo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s and health risks.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ost In Des Moines, WA

The cost of crawl space water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Dehumidification and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and level of moisture
Structural repair and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age and materials needed
Mold rem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and level of mold growth
Free consultation and assessment Free None

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Extraction

Q: What causes water damage in my crawl space?

A: Water damage in your crawl space can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, flooding, and poor drainage. It’s essential to address these issues quickly to prevent costly damage and health risks.

Q: How long does crawl space water extraction take?

A: The length of time required for crawl space water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Typically, our team can complete the process within 3-5 days.

Q: Is crawl space water extraction covered by insurance?

A: In some cases, crawl space water extraction may be covered by insurance. But, it’s essential to review your policy and contact your insurance provider to find out the extent of coverage.

Q: Can I do crawl space water extraction myself?

A: While DIY water extraction may seem like a cost-effective option, it’s not always the best choice. Without proper training and equipment, you may exacerbate the damage and create safety hazards.

Q: How can I prevent water damage in my crawl space?

A: Preventing water damage in your crawl space needs regular maintenance and inspections. Be sure to check your crawl space regularly for signs of moisture and address any issues quickly.
